Answer to Question 1

ANS: B
Cancer cytogenetics is a field that is built on the finding of nonrandom chromosome abnormalities in many types of cancer. Cytogenetic analysis of malignant cells can help determine the diagnosis and probable prognosis of a hematologic malignancy.

In the United States, congenital cytomegalovirus causes one child to become disabled almost every hour. CMV is the leading preventable viral cause of development disability in newborns. These disabilities include hearing or vision loss, and cerebral palsy.

Hip fractures are the most serious consequences of osteoporosis. The incidence of hip fractures increases with each decade among patients in their 60s to patients in their 90s for both women and men of all populations. Men and women older than 80 years of age show the highest incidence of hip fractures.
